Clovelly is a delightful village with pretty cobbled streets and a lovely harbour.
The pretty cobbled streets of Clovelly.
Head to the coast and enjoy the sea air and the dramatic cliftop walks.
Instow has miles of golden sands, perfect for families.
Instow faces Appledore and a passenger ferry can take you between the two during the summer months.
The UNESCO World Heritage Site at Braunton Burrows - 1000 hectares of sand dunes leading to the three mile long beach.
The north coast has wonderful spots to sit or to walk along the coast path for miles and miles no matter the season.
